McNultt, formerly a prominent merchant of Sacramento, committed suicide in San Francisco, on the 29th ult. by shooting himself through the heart with a pistol. Mr. McNulty had been crippled by fires and losses, and latterly had taken to the bowl to drown his sorrows. His wife was on her way to the east, leaxing him, and he went to San Francisco to endeavor to persuade her to return, when the deed was committed. He was taken to Sacramento for interment.Jmxns J.
